For those that don't know, the Soro is a Class A single-ended line only 18 watt per channel integrated amplifier, with 4 inputs & tape loop. Unlike most other tube amplifiers on the market at the moment, the Soro does not display it's tubes for all to see - everything is concealed within the amplifier's case. The final verse offers a glimmer of hope, a possibility for connection and happiness, as the narrator imagines a moment of shared laughter and love with their significant other. The narrator's own heart is black, and they long for the transformation that painting their red door black might bring. The reference to the line of black cars and flowers symbolizes a funeral procession and the feeling of mourning and loss that accompanies it. The following verses describe the narrator's detachment from the world around them, as they observe the passing of time, the loss of love and the indifference of others. They want to erase all colors and immerse in absolute blackness, a metaphor for their state of mind. The opening line "I see your red door and I want it painted black" suggests the protagonist's rejection of the colorful and cheerful world outside, as they feel consumed by darkness and despair.
